DRYER VENT CLEANING IN DALLAS, TX

Dryer vent cleaning removes the lint packing the duct between your dryer and the outside. Lint is highly flammable, a restricted vent traps the heat that ignites it, and clogged dryer vents cause thousands of U.S. house fires every year. Brown Chimney cleans the full run in Dallas for $249 on a standard ground-floor wall exit, up to $449 for roof exits, runs over 25 feet, multiple bends, or heavy buildup.

The result gets proven, not promised: airflow is measured at the cap before and after, so you see the restriction removed in numbers. Dallas has its own twist — dryers run hard year-round in a warm climate, exterior vent hoods sit in the Texas sun and grow brittle, and birds that nest in an unscreened vent hood are a genuine local hazard. The Work

What a vent cleaning does for a Dallas home.

A dryer doesn't dry clothes — airflow does. As lint narrows the duct, cycles stretch, the machine runs hotter, the thermal fuse trips, and the utility bill climbs. Most "broken dryer" calls we hear about in Dallas turn out to be blocked vents, not failed appliances — and in a warm climate where dryers run year-round, that lint packs up faster than you'd think.

We work the entire run with rotary brushes from both ends, vacuum-extracting what breaks loose — including the bends where clogs hide. The exterior cap gets cleared and checked, because a sun-brittle or bird-blocked vent hood chokes airflow as badly as lint does. Then the after-test. When to book

What are the signs your dryer vent needs cleaning?

A restricted vent tells on itself — through the dryer, the laundry room, and the utility bill. In a warm climate where dryers run year-round, most Dallas households hit two or three of these.

01

Clothes take more than one cycle to dry

02

The dryer or the laundry room feels unusually hot

03

A burning smell during dry cycles

04

Visible lint around the exterior vent hood — or no air exiting at all

05

It's been more than 12 months since the vent was cleaned

06

The dryer shuts off mid-cycle on thermal overload

What to expect

What happens during a dryer vent cleaning?

A standard Dallas visit runs about 30–45 minutes, including the airflow numbers that prove the vent is actually open.

01

Airflow test — before

The run is measured at the exterior cap before anything is touched. This number is your baseline — and your proof at the end.

02

Disconnect & access

The dryer is pulled, the transition hose disconnected, and both ends of the duct opened for full-run access.

03

Rotary brush cleaning

Brushes sized to the duct work the entire run from both directions, with vacuum extraction capturing lint as it breaks loose — including the bends where clogs hide.

04

Cap inspection & clearing

The exterior cap is cleared and checked — a crushed or screen-blocked cap chokes airflow as badly as lint does.

05

Reconnect & airflow test — after

The vent is properly reconnected and the airflow measured again. Before-and-after numbers go in your report: the restriction is gone, and you can see it.

How often should a Dallas dryer vent be cleaned?

Once a year for most households — sooner with heavy laundry volume, long duct runs, or pets. In a warm climate, Dallas dryers run year-round, which packs lint faster than a seasonal schedule would.

Can a clogged dryer vent really cause a fire?

Yes. Lint is highly flammable and a blocked vent traps the heat that ignites it — clogged dryer vents cause thousands of U.S. house fires annually. It's one of the most preventable risks in a home, which is why the fix is a routine $249 visit.
